About This Funder

The Barnabas Charitable Trust is a registered UK charity (Charity Commission no. 326748) dedicated to providing targeted financial relief to individuals in necessitous circumstances who are or have been engaged in full-time Christian service—such as ministers, missionaries, and church workers—and their families or dependents, particularly those not in paid employment due to retirement, hardship, or life changes. Rooted in Christian values of compassion, stewardship, service, and fellowship, the Trust adopts a highly focused, case-by-case approach, emphasizing direct personal aid over broader programmes, with decisions made by a small trustee board to uphold careful stewardship for those who have served without material reward.

It funds emergency relief, living expenses, and hardship support through unrestricted grants for personal use, primarily to UK-resident individuals with a proven history of Christian ministry. Occasionally, it supports small organisations or groups directly aiding eligible beneficiaries, but prioritises tangible relief for those facing financial need after long service, including those who served internationally but now reside in the UK.

Eligibility is strictly limited to Christian-only beneficiaries in the UK demonstrating financial hardship and a record of full-time service; organisations must have direct links to such individuals, with no income thresholds but a preference for smaller entities. Unsolicited applications are not accepted—support arises via referrals from trusted Christian networks, with trustees assessing cases quarterly on a rolling basis, requesting evidence of need and service.

Typical grants range from £500 to £5,000, rarely larger, excluding projects, capital costs, or general organisational funding.
